As our Safety Advisor, you'll help build and sustain a Safety-First culture across our Tasmania operations.
Supporting projects in both Hobart and Launceston, you'll partner with project teams to provide practical advice, strengthen compliance and drive positive environment, health, safety and quality outcomes from preconstruction through to completion.
Key Responsibilities
• Promote and support SHAPE's Safety-First culture across projects and teams
• Provide advisory support on EHSQ systems, policies and procedures
• Conduct site inspections, observations and hazard identification activities
• Review Safe Work Method Statements (SWMS) and ensure compliance
• Support incident investigations, reporting and corrective actions
• Assist project teams with risk registers, project delivery plans and EHSQ processes
What You'll Bring
You're a practical safety professional who enjoys working closely with site teams and influencing positive safety behaviours across live construction environments.
• Qualification in Work Health and Safety or Construction Management
• Demonstrated EHSQ experience within the construction industry
• Experience with safety inspections, risk assessments and investigations
• Strong understanding of WHS legislation and safe systems of work
• Ability to influence and coach project teams to improve safety outcomes
• Strong organisational skills and ability to manage competing priorities
• Collaborative approach aligned with SHAPE's Safety-First culture
